Output 74b87b2d754bc64ec4b7db578ea3d54fc4b54c7a2dbfe1abac012641133f5626:19

value
8388608
script pubkey
OP_0 OP_PUSHBYTES_20 773c4c76dd934a689d96e7a3e627b7ba9be125a5
address
bc1qwu7ycakajd9x38vku737vfahh2d7zfd9sl765e
transaction
74b87b2d754bc64ec4b7db578ea3d54fc4b54c7a2dbfe1abac012641133f5626
confirmations
38433
spent
true